Finding Clarity and Focus: Your Guide to Finding a Psychiatrist for ADHD Near You

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that impacts millions of grownups and children worldwide. Identified by persistent pat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ity, ADHD can substantially affect a person's every day life, impacting everything from academic or expert efficiency to individual relationships and general wellness. If you think you or an enjoyed one may have ADHD, seeking expert help is the crucial very first action towards understanding and managing the condition successfully. A psychiatrist, with their customized medical training, plays a crucial role in the diagnosis and treatment of ADHD. This article will assist you through the procedure of discovering a certified psychiatrist for ADHD near you, describing why a psychiatrist is the best choice, what to expect throughout your search and preliminary consultations, and how to browse prospective barriers to access the care you need.

Why a Psychiatrist is Essential for ADHD Diagnosis and Management

While different professionals can contribute to ADHD care, a psychiatrist brings an unique and necessary ability to the table, especially when it pertains to diagnosis and extensive treatment planning. Psychiatrists are medical doctors (MDs or DOs) who have actually completed specialized training in psychiatry. This strenuous medical background supplies them with a deep understanding of the brain and body, permitting them to:

  • Accurately Diagnose ADHD: psychiatrists adhd near me are trained to perform thorough assessments, considering not just the behavioral signs of ADHD however likewise potential medical and mental elements that might be adding to these symptoms. They can differentiate ADHD from other conditions that might present likewise, such as anxiety, depression, or learning disabilities.
  • Prescribe and Manage Medication: A foundation of ADHD treatment for numerous people involves medication. Psychiatrists are licensed to prescribe medication, consisting of stimulant and non-stimulant alternatives, which are frequently reliable in managing ADHD signs. They possess the proficiency to thoroughly select the most appropriate medication, figure out ideal dosages, and screen for possible adverse effects. This medical oversight is important, especially for individuals with pre-existing health conditions or those taking other medications.
  • Address Co-occurring Conditions: ADHD frequently co-exists with other mental health conditions like anxiety, depression, bipolar disorder, and substance utilize disorders. Psychiatrists are proficient at identifying and dealing with these co-morbidities, offering integrated care that resolves the full spectrum of a person's mental health requirements.
  • Supply Holistic Treatment Plans: While medication is a considerable component, effective ADHD management typically involves a multi-faceted method. Psychiatrists can develop comprehensive treatment plans that might consist of medication management, therapy (such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y or CBT), way of life modifications, and instructional or workplace lodgings, guaranteeing a holistic strategy customized to the individual's distinct circumstance.

In essence, picking a psychiatrist for ADHD care guarantees you are getting medical know-how paired with mental health expertise, providing a robust structure for precise diagnosis, reliable treatment, and long-term management of the condition.

What to Expect in Your First Appointment

Your first appointment with a psychiatrist for ADHD will generally involve a thorough evaluation focused on understanding your symptoms, history, and requires. Be prepared for:

  • In-depth Interview: The psychiatrist will ask comprehensive concerns about your present signs, their beginning, seriousness, and influence on your life. They will likewise ask about your developmental history, family history of mental health conditions, case history, and any previous treatments you have gotten.
  • Diagnostic Assessment: The psychiatrist will use standardized diagnostic requirements, frequently laid out in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5), to assess whether you fulfill the criteria for ADHD. They may utilize score scales or questionnaires to gather further information.
  • Physical and Neurological Examination (Potentially): While not constantly needed for ADHD diagnosis itself, the psychiatrist might perform a brief physical or neurological examination to rule out any underlying medical conditions that might be adding to your symptoms.
  • Conversation of Treatment Options: After the assessment, the psychiatrist will talk about prospective treatment options with you. This might include medication, therapy, or a mix of both. They will explain the benefits and risks of different methods and work collaboratively with you to establish an individualized treatment strategy.
  • Chance to Ask Questions: Your very first appointment is likewise your opportunity to ask questions. Prepare a list of questions in advance to ensure you deal with all your concerns and get a clear understanding of the diagnosis and treatment procedure.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What is the distinction between a psychiatrist, psychologist, and therapist for ADHD?A: Psychiatrists are medical doctors (MDs or DOs) who can prescribe medication. Psychologists hold postgraduate degrees (PhDs or PsyDs) and provide therapy and mental screening but usually can not prescribe medication. Therapists (LCSWs, LMFTs, LPCs, etc) offer numerous kinds of therapy and therapy but are not medical doctors and can not prescribe medication. For ADHD diagnosis and medication management, a psychiatrist is generally important.

Q: How often will I require to see a psychiatrist for ADHD management?A: The frequency of visits will differ. At first, you might have more regular consultations for diagnosis and medication titration. As soon as a steady treatment plan is developed, follow-up consultations might be less regular, maybe every few months, for continuous monitoring and medication management.
